1
Joined in agreement or purpose
Working together as one group because you agree or have the same goal.
Användningsmönster:
[group] is united in [purpose/action]
Vanligt misstag:
Learners sometimes confuse 'united' with 'together'. 'Together' refers to physical proximity or simultaneous action, while 'united' emphasizes shared purpose or agreement.

2
Formed into one whole
Made into one thing by bringing parts together.

stand united
1/stˈænd junˈaɪtɪd/
fixed phrase
Remain together in support
To stay together and support each other.
Exempel
- We must stand united against injustice.
- The community stood united after the disaster.
united front
1/junˈaɪtɪd fɹˈʌnt/
fixed phrase
Group showing public agreement
When people show they agree and work together, especially to others outside the group.
Exempel
- The parents presented a united front to their children.
- The company leaders showed a united front during the negotiations.
